O2 Launches Daisy: A Scam-Fighting AI Granny

A UK mobile network provider, O2, has launched a clever AI solution to combat scam calls. Enter Daisy, the virtual “granny” whose job is to keep fraudsters occupied by engaging them in endless conversations, wasting their time and limiting their ability to scam others.

Daisy’s Strategy: Engaging Scam Callers for Maximum Distraction

Daisy works using multiple AI systems that transcribe, analyze, and respond to scam calls in real time. She chats about trivial subjects—such as her cat or upcoming family gatherings—drawing the scammer into long-winded exchanges. This helps ensure that scammers are distracted and can’t make additional calls.

Raising Awareness and Enhancing Protection

In addition to providing an entertaining solution to scam calls, O2 encourages people to report suspicious activity to 7726. This helps block fraudulent numbers and strengthens the company’s anti-fraud measures.

Addressing the Rising Fraud Concerns

Nearly 70% of UK residents worry about falling victim to fraud, and O2 aims to reduce the impact of these scams by keeping the scammers engaged for longer, making it harder for them to target the vulnerable.
